South African College Private School (SACPS) SA College Private School ( SACPS ) is an independent co-ed school situated in Arcadia in the centre of Pretoria , within walking distance of the Union Buildings and alongside the Apies river that dissects Pretoria. South African College Private School strives to develop the rich potential of every one of its diverse multicultural complement of learners by instilling the moral, social and academic skills and knowledge required for a life of service, leadership and personal fulfilment. The spirit of inclusivity ensures that a wide spectrum of learners from Grade R to Grade 12 is catered for holistically in the school’s efforts to inculcate excellence in academic achievement, independence of thought, respect for all, responsibility and creativity which characteristics should epitomise the useful and valuable citizens the school wishes to produce. This gem of a school is ideally situated for parents WHO WORK IN THE CITY providing them with a one stop facility. They can work in the city centre and drop off their children before 07:00 and collect them safely between 14:30 and 17:00 of an afternoon, the latter collection time being applicable to parents making use of the school’s very affordable After Care centre. As part of SA College Private School ’s Corporate Responsibility Programme, the school offers Saturday School classes to both Primary and Senior school learners from the far corners of Tshwane and its environments at a minimal charge – this service to the local community allows learners from other schools and the SACPS to attend classes throughout the year over weekends, including holidays and public holidays to be taught by the very best educators drawn from SACPS and neighbouring schools.
